Woman attempts suicide outside Huzurabad police station

A woman attempted suicide outside the Huzurabad police station in Karimnagar, alleging police inaction over unpaid compensation promised after a divorce following a dowry harassment case. Alert police personnel prevented the attempt

Karimnagar: A woman, Gandrakota Pavani, on Tuesday attempted suicide in front of the Huzurabad police station, protesting alleged police negligence in delivering justice to her.

Pavani tried to end her life by dousing herself with diesel. However, alert police personnel foiled the attempt.


A native of Thigaram village in Station Ghanpur mandal of Jangaon district, Pavani married Kanchapu Aravind of Rampur in Huzurabad mandal two years ago. A few days after the marriage, she lodged a complaint against her husband, alleging that Aravind began harassing her for additional dowry. Police subsequently registered a dowry harassment case against him.

Later, Pavani and Aravind obtained a divorce through a community elders’ panchayat. At the time of the divorce, Aravind had reportedly promised to pay Rs.9 lakh as compensation to Pavani.

As the compensation amount was not paid, Pavani approached the police. Despite making several rounds of the police station over the past few months, she alleged that no action was taken. On Tuesday, she again approached the police along with her parents. As there was no response, she staged protest demonstrations at the police station and later at Ambedkar Chowk.

Agitated over what she described as the negligent attitude of the police, Pavani attempted to end her life by dousing herself with diesel. Alert police personnel prevented the act and escorted her inside the police station.
